Haliburton Forest is a private land stewardship company based in central Ontario. It owns and manages 100,000 acres of hardwood timberland along the southeastern boundary of Algonquin Park. The company consists of two divisions. The first is the Tourism & Recreation division, which offers dogsledding, snowmobiling, camping, hiking, hunting, fishing, canopy tours, and group experiences. The second is the Forest Products division, which manufactures hardwood lumber, wood fibre products, split firewood, log homes, custom furniture, canoeing paddles, and more. Haliburton Forest was the first forest in Canada to be certified as sustainable by the Forest Stewardship Council and is proud to be recognized as a world leader in land stewardship, ecotourism, and wood processing.
